> Has anybody gotten Net2Phone to work through STN?

Did you try following the instructions that net2phone has for getting
through a firewall? They're here:
http://www.net2phone.com/english/help/otherprob.html
You'll also have to configure STN to allow the ports you choose. On the web
administer, select Advanced Setup->Network->Configure->User Specified
Inbound Services
Choose the following:
Service=USER1 # the first one available
EN=Checked
Prot=both
Port=23432 # out of the clear blue sky
IP=192.168.0.12 # this will probably be different for you
Once you hit OK at the bottom, the changes take effect right away, no need
to reboot.
You'll have to edit the C:\windows\net2phone.ini file. When I did it looked
kinda like this:
____________BEGIN of net2phone.ini_____________
[Config]
PriCall=call1.net2phone.com
AltCall=call2.net2phone.com
RegServer1=reg1.net2phone.com
RegServer2=reg2.net2phone.com
TCPPORT=23432
UDPPORT=23432
[AccountInfo]
Source=IDT_ENGLISH
[URLS]
FAQ=http://www.net2phone.com/%L%/help
...
____________END of net2phone.ini_____________
When this was done, I restarted the net2phone program and the setup wizard
ran. It successfully completed the network test. I was unable to finish
the test though, seems the recording option of my sound card stopped
working. I guess that's what I get for buying a $7 sound card at Fry's :/
